Compare all specifications:
2001 Acura TL | 2013 Mercedes-Benz C | |
Make | Acura | Mercedes-Benz |
Model | TL | C |
Year Released | 2001 | 2013 |
Body Type | Sedan | Coupe |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 3210 cc | 1800 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 226 HP | 198 HP |
Engine RPM | 5600 RPM | 5500 RPM |
Torque | 294 Nm | 310 Nm |
Engine Bore Size | 89 mm | 82 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 86 mm | 85 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 9.8:1 | 9.3 : 1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line - Premium |
Top Speed | 209 km/hour | 210 km/hour |
Drive Type | Front | Rear |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 4 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1575 kg | 1550 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4910 mm | 4590 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1800 mm | 1997 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1370 mm | 1406 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2720 mm | 2760 mm |
